spec/integration/mixin_spec.rb in dry-container-0.1.0 vs spec/integration/mixin_spec.rb in dry-container-0.2.0

- old
+ new

@@ -1,17 +1,19 @@ RSpec.describe Dry::Container::Mixin do describe 'extended' do - let(:container) do + let(:klass) do Class.new { extend Dry::Container::Mixin } end + let(:container) { klass } it_behaves_like 'a container' end describe 'included' do - let(:container) do - Class.new { include Dry::Container::Mixin }.new + let(:klass) do + Class.new { include Dry::Container::Mixin } end + let(:container) { klass.new } it_behaves_like 'a container' end end